Advanced Recording Operations Using special effects - Digital effect (1) In CAMERA mode, select FN, then press the center z on the control button. The PAGE1 screen appears. (2) Select PAGE3, then press the center z on the control button. The PAGE3 screen appears. (3) Select DIG EFFT, then press the center z on the control button. The DIG EFFT screen used for selecting the desired digital effect mode appears. (4) Select the desired digital effect mode, then press the center z on the control button. In STILL and LUMI. modes, the still image is stored in memory. (5) Select -/+, then press the center z on the control button repeatedly to adjust the effect. You can also adjust the effect by pressing b/B repeatedly after you select -/+. Items to be adjusted STILL The rate of the still image you want to superimpose on the moving picture FLASH The interval of flash motion LUMI. The color scheme of the area in the still image which is to be swapped with a moving picture TRAIL The vanishing time of the incidental image SLOW SHTR Shutter speed. The larger the shutter speed number, the slower the shutter speed. OLD MOVIE No adjustment necessary (6) Press DISPLAY to turn off the screen buttons. 1 FN 2 PAGE3 3-5 DIG EFFT DIG EFFT OFF OK SLOW OLD SHTR MOVIE STILL FLASH LUMI.
